"Spiderman" Arrested After Climb For Climate (VIDEO)

First Posted: 7/3/09 Updated: 5/25/11

Famous building scaler Alain "Spiderman" Robert was arrested after climbing the Royal Bank of Scotland in Sydney, Australia.

He had climbed up and displayed a banner advertising One Hundred Months, the organization that believes we have a 100 month deadline to fix global warming or suffer dire irreversible consequences.
